Window Well Service in Kansas City, KS

Window well services involve the installation, repair, and maintenance of protective enclosures around basement windows. These structures help prevent water intrusion, improve safety, and allow natural light to enter basement areas. Projects typically include installing new window wells for homes with below-grade windows, repairing or replacing damaged wells, and ensuring proper drainage to avoid flooding or water damage. Property owners often want to understand the materials used, the durability of the wells, and how the installation process will affect their landscaping or existing structures before requesting service.

Homeowners usually seek window well services when upgrading or renovating their basements, addressing water leakage issues, or enhancing safety features around basement windows. It’s important to consider the size and type of window wells suitable for the property, as well as any local building codes or drainage requirements. Clear communication about the scope of work, the materials involved, and the expected results can help property owners make informed decisions and ensure their basement windows are protected and functional.

Window Well Service Questions

What is a window well? A window well is a structure installed outside basement windows to prevent soil from blocking light and to provide safe egress.

Why install or replace a window well? Installing or replacing a window well helps improve drainage, prevents water intrusion, and enhances safety around basement windows.

What types of window wells are available? Common types include metal, plastic, and stone window wells, each offering different durability and aesthetic options.

How can a window well be maintained? Regular inspection for debris, cracks, or rust and cleaning out leaves or dirt helps keep window wells functioning properly.
